Transaction 503307127437386756138e750ce41dd52a14a6a93d50c81e111dbf342e9693ba
1 Input
1 Output
-
503307127437386756138e750ce41dd52a14a6a93d50c81e111dbf342e9693ba:0
- value
- 154264
- script pubkey
- OP_0 OP_PUSHBYTES_20 d015bec202b7dea8bb7d61bd543609cfc8eb2d73
- address
- bc1q6q2masszkl023wmavx74gdsfelywkttnkq3uqq